This just isn't right. Most of the tax gap isn't "dodged by the richest 1%" - as @danneidle.bsky.social reports, about £2bn of it is from the wealthy (and another £2bn from other individuals). By far the highest amount - £28bn - is uncollected from small businesses. taxpolicy.org.uk/2025/06/19/t...
